自定义博客皮肤VIP专享

*博客头图:

格式为PNG、JPG,宽度*高度大于1920*100像素,不超过2MB,主视觉建议放在右侧,请参照线上博客头图

请上传大于1920*100像素的图片!

博客底图:

图片格式为PNG、JPG,不超过1MB,可上下左右平铺至整个背景

栏目图:

图片格式为PNG、JPG,图片宽度*高度为300*38像素,不超过0.5MB

主标题颜色:

RGB颜色,例如:#AFAFAF

Hover:

RGB颜色,例如:#AFAFAF

副标题颜色:

RGB颜色,例如:#AFAFAF

自定义博客皮肤

-+
  • 博客(222)
  • 资源 (10)
  • 收藏
  • 关注

原创 dm 8 linux 系统rpm方式配置odbc开发环境

说明:测试环境下探索配置,并不能保证配置规范和绝对有效性。另,转载请注明出处。1、操作系统安装rpm包 (相关包上传或镜像挂载不做说明)rpm -ivh unixODBC-2.3.1-11.el7.x86_64.rpmrpm -ivh unixODBC-devel-2.3.1-11.el7.x86_64.rpm核实[dmdba@localhost ~]$ odbcinst -junixODBC 2.3.1DRIVERS............: /etc/odbcinst.iniSYS.

2021-01-06 16:02:44 347

原创 达梦数据库还原表测试(验证还原表的恢复及是否应用归档)

一、验证删除后是否能恢复1、建测试表sysdba.test6create table test6 as select id from sysobjects;executed successfully2、备份test6SQL> backup table test6;executed successfully备份位置SQL> select backup_path,type,backup_time,base_name from v$backupset;LINEID ...

2021-01-04 15:56:04 672 1

原创 dataguard 中log_file_name_convert、db_file_name_convert的作用

在搭建dataguard时,如果主备的环境目录不一致会用到log_file_name_convert,和db_file_name_convert,12c以后还有pdb_file_name_convert。这些convert参数的具体作用是当主备数据文件目录和日志目录不一致时要指定的转换对应关系,用于使用rman异机或rman的active duplicate。有时候有以下错误的理解。参考mos((Doc ID 272896.1))1、认为db_file_name_convert参数可以实现renam

2020-06-20 14:02:58 1169

原创 linux 7 配置chrony的客户端后,侦测时间是否同步

有些版本的操作系统在镜像里已不包含ntp包了,linux7 可以使用chrony来代替ntp。chrony服务端和客户单的配置有很多blog有说明,这里只描述下检测是否成功1.第一种方法直接对比ntp时间服务器和客户端服务器的时间。这个是明显的直观的2.第二种方法如果配置多台client可以比较相互之间是否有差异,不过这个有一定概率性,除非clinet数量比较多3.第三种方...

2020-03-11 10:11:33 3525

原创 linux 7 关闭透明大页

如题,关闭透明大页推荐方式是vi /etc/rc.local 添加如下内容if test -f /sys/kernel/mm/transparent_hugepage/enabled; thenecho never > /sys/kernel/mm/transparent_hugepage/enabledfiif test -f /sys/kernel/mm/t...

2020-03-10 17:37:10 1186

原创 12C R2 公用用户和本地用户的创建和授权

公有用户是cdb级的,本地用户跟原来11g版本的用户是一致的没有变化下面示例说明创建公有用户的注意事项创建公有用户需要以下几点1、注意parameter common_user_prefix的值,这个参数可以修改,但一般不建议修改show parameter common_user_prefix的前缀实际创建用户时用C##和c##都可以,实际是C##2、关键字containercont...

2019-05-30 10:59:35 1173

翻译 spm手工创建sql_plan_baseline

本文参考崔华老师的书1)创建一个测试表create table t2 as select * from dba_objects;create index idx_t2 on t2(object_id);2)做一次查询select /*+ no_index(t2 idx_t2) */object_name,object_id from t2 where object_id=4;查一下执...

2018-11-30 15:29:59 276

转载 12c RAC Hub Node 和 Leaf Node以及与11gR2版本的普通Node区别

Oracle Database 12c 新特性:RAC Cluster Hub Node 和 Leaf Node原文出处:https://blog.csdn.net/qyq88888/article/details/62044505在 Oracle Database 12c 的 Cluster 中引入了很多新特性和新概念,其中重复最多的几个名词除了 Flex Cluster、Flex ...

2018-09-27 14:41:11 503

原创 /bin/ld: warning: libstdc++.so.5 linux7.1打12.1的psu遇到warning

新装一台单机oracle 12.1 在linux7.1系统上,打psu时遇到warningPatching component oracle.javavm.containers, 12.1.0.2.0...OPatch found the word "warning" in the stderr of the make command.Please look at this stderr....

2018-09-05 17:21:54 683

原创 11G RAC 私网直连CRS-5818 CRS-2757

              11G RAC 私网直连服务器报错CRS-5818 CRS-2757 客户一套linux6.x系列2节点11g r2 RAC 由于某些原因需要关闭服务器,再次重启时2节点主板故障,启动失败。单独启1节点报错2017-07-28 15:48:39.632[/u01/app/11.2.0.3/grid/bin/orarootagent.bin(5125)]CRS-...

2018-08-01 10:54:31 1669

转载 leading use_nl() 与 ordered use_nl()

此文章为转载,源文出处http://www.360doc.com/content/10/0715/14/865221_39175609.shtml首先我们来分别介绍一下这四个hint的概念: 1. ORDERED hint:    ordered hint 指示oracle按照from关键字后的表顺序来进行连接。如果没有及时收集统计信息,查询优化器没有得到足够信息,此时你可以自行选择适当的inne...

2018-05-25 14:11:23 892

原创 11gr2 RAC 修改127.0.0.1为实际ip地址

一套新建rac ,监听显示127.0.0.1,想改为实际ip地址[grid@node1 ~]$ lsnrctl statusListener Log File /u01/gridbase/diag/tnslsnr/node1/listener/alert/log.xmlListening Endpoints Summary... (DESCRIPTION=(ADDRESS=...

2018-04-27 10:07:44 503

转载 OGG-1232 TCP/IP error 131

今天遇到一个错误,我负责抽取、投递端                       OGG-01232     TCP/IP error 131     这是一个dpe投递进程的report报错,肯定是网络有问题。目前dpe进程abend ,rep端的进程应该不是abend,但其rba应该是不走的,有可能是其存放trail文件的目录满造成的中断,导致dpe进程未写完一

2018-03-15 17:31:52 741

转载 ORA-39097:Data Pump job encountered unexpected error 06502

      由于1套数据库迁移(10g双机到11g rac上)使用数据泵导入导出时出现坏块。这是一个分区表,10231事件等跳不过坏块,坏块在表上,并且有多处。将分区表的所有分区取出,创建一个parfile(aa.par)内容就是:              tables=table:pxxxxa,table:pxxxxb,....然后导出expdp user/password  dumpfile...

2018-03-13 10:52:02 3883

翻译 OGG-01164 Column Index (0) out of Sequence 处理

一套ogg rep端 报错OGG-01164 Column Index (0) out of Sequence XXX开始以为是def文件有问题,比较抽取端和复制端的def中的改表,发现是完全一致的。discard文件也没有异常报错。查询mos发现文章描述很详细,研究一下。Replicat Abends with OGG-01164 Column Index (0) out of

2018-03-09 11:18:10 1039

原创 关于ogg add trandata的作用

    昨天,客户反映一套ogg的rep进程挂掉。查看report报错是error mapping,检查参数文件配置、表结构、以及源端表的定义文件都没有问题,手动调整rba也不管用。discard文件里显示compressed update 。使用logdump 打开该文件定位到该rba下 ,显示io操作使update但是before immage 只有第五列(被更新的列),而没有主键列,主键列是...

2018-03-07 10:44:31 8860 2

转载 OGG-01028 Incompatible Record

由于rep端异常关机或者rep端的mgr没有正常关机导致的trail文件不完整。查询mosHow to recover from an OGG-01028 Incompatible Record if the trail is not corrupt (Doc ID 1507462.1)Oracle GoldenGate - Version 9.5_EA and laterInformation ...

2018-03-02 10:56:50 1986

原创 数据库通过数据泵由10.2.0.5到11.2.0.4遭遇ORA-39126、ORA-01555

2018-02-08 16:10:10 549

原创 ogg getupdatebefores参数影响dml的操作

ogg getupdatebefores参数对于dml的增删改有哪些影响。首先部署ogg要开启最小补充日志SQL> select supplemental_log_data_min from v$database;SUPPLEME--------YES查看数据库是否开启全列补充日志SQL> select supplemental_log_data_all from v

2018-01-09 16:07:35 5097

原创 RMAN RESTORE fails with RMAN-06023 or ORA-19505 or RMAN-06100

某个库用nbu做了一个全库备份但不知什么原因,输出日志没了,为了验证备份有效性,使用restore validate database 验证备份有效性。报错RMAN> restore validate database;Starting restore at 07-SEP-2007 20:38:21allocated channel: ORA_DISK_1chann

2018-01-02 11:05:40 798

原创 图形界面扩容缩容acfs文件系统

oracle RAC 使用图形界面扩容缩容先查看我原来的挂载点目录/arch 总大小为3.5G[root@rac2 ~]# df -hFilesystem Size Used Avail Use% Mounted on/dev/mapper/vg_rac1-lv_root 25G 12G 12G 51% /tmpfs

2017-12-19 16:52:11 1481

翻译 ORACLE ACFS 文件系统的扩容 oracle 官方文档

How To Resize An ACFS Filesystem/ASM Volume (ADVM) (文档 ID 1173978.1)In this DocumentGoalSolution  Community DiscussionsReferencesAPPLIES TO:Oracle Database - Enterprise Edition

2017-12-19 15:56:50 1776

转载 关于local_listener 和 remote_listener

local_listener是在一套Oracle系统上(一个主机上可以安装多套Oracle软件系统的)指定的一个监听程序[应该是在一个主机的多个账户上安装的多套Oracle软件系统公用一个local_listener,即一个主机有一个local_listener]。PMON进程将在该Oracle系统上的(后于该监听程序启动的)实例的信息注册给该监听程序,这就是所谓的动态监听功能。     

2017-10-25 14:37:06 2417

原创 关于mirror、failgroup、redundancy 的概念理解

个人的一些理解,并不一定十分准确mirror、failgroup、redundancy 分别对应(镜像、故障组、冗余)的中文意思。镜像,通常在外部存储上做raid 1能实现基本的镜像(两块磁盘就能做镜像),目前在实际生产中有用到raid0 和raid1的结合,当然更多的是raid 3 、raid 5、raid 6等使用校验来实现冗余备份故障组,oracle的镜像是通过failgroup来实

2017-10-23 15:02:19 1301

原创 由于源端和目标端主键不一致问题导致的error mapping

昨天,一套新建ogg的rep怎么都起不来,查看report只是提示源端的表和目标端的表mapping 有问题。由于生产系统信息不能取出,凭记忆叙述下。        分别desc,取出两端的表结构,一行一行做比对(源端和目标端列不一致,需要列映射),从列类型到长度以及各种对应变换都没有问题。记录rep目前的seqno和rba号,跳转2个trial,start之后,表rba正常走,s

2017-09-26 13:18:19 1364

翻译 solaris系统下使用asm的bug (solaris系统248天未重启导致asm进程异常)

Solaris: Process spins/ASM and DB Crash if RAC Instance Is Up For > 248 Days by LMHB with ORA-29770 (文档 ID 2159643.1)转到底部In this DocumentDescr

2017-09-11 17:07:31 967

原创 Oracle dba和sysdba的区别

之前老是把dba和sysdba混为一体,今天看到论坛在讨论两者的区别,特记录如下:SYSDBA不是权限,当用户以SYSDBA身份登陆数据库时,登陆用户都会变成SYS.sysdba身份登陆可以打开,关闭数据库,创建SPFILE,对数据库进行恢复操作等,而这些是DBA角色无法实现的;sysdba 是系统权限,dba是用户对象权限;sysdba,是管理oracle实例的,它的存在不依赖于

2017-08-07 11:12:16 2890

翻译 After RAC ONE NODE Failover and relocate ,instance_number 和 oracle_sid changes

一套RAC ONE NODE 数据库由于asmb进程异常导致数据库failover,reolocate回原来的节点后,发现instance_number由1变为2和oracle_sid由xxx_1 变为xxx_2,查阅官方文档Instance Name changes during RAC One Node Failover/Switchover (文档

2017-08-01 16:11:05 294

原创 ogg 有集成捕捉模式转换为普通模式

由集成模式转换为普通模式就是由普通模式转换成集成模式的逆过程。直接上代码,不解释Program Status Group Lag at Chkpt Time Since ChkptMANAGER RUNNING EXTRACT ABENDED DPEMO

2017-07-19 15:44:42 1256

原创 ogg由普通模式转换成集成捕捉模式实验

转换条件查看上篇:将ogg捕捉模式由普通模式转换成集成捕捉客户有一个数据库需要将源端抽取由普通模式转换成集成模式,详细诊断转换成集成模式的原因查看:ogg-00723 ogg-00715具体步骤:打开虚拟机GGSCI (og1) > info allProgram Status Group Lag at Chkpt Time Since

2017-07-19 15:29:15 1544

翻译 GG Extract Report Shows "Purging Transaction", WARNING OGG-00723, OGG-00715,

客户某套ogg总是莫名丢数,检查各个配置文件,均配置正确。查看discard文件和rpt文件发现警告WARNING OGG-00723, OGG-00715,此时可以确定是源端的抽取漏抽数据。查询mos发现文章1458472.1有比较清楚的解释。Applies to: Oracle GoldenGate - Version 11.1.1.0.0 and laterInfor

2017-07-19 15:07:49 1605

转载 mos文章将ogg捕捉模式由普通模式转换成集成捕捉

How To Upgrade From Goldengate Classic Extract To Integrated Extract (文档 ID 1484313.1) 转--------------------------------------------------------------------------------In this Document

2017-07-19 14:42:12 819

转载 oracle drop、truncate 分区表分区注意

由于客户某表月初通过ogg导入数据较多,ogg未能完成。因此决定使用数据泵临时导入。停止ogg,删除表分区数据。通过delete加条件筛选数据,发现数据量较大,尝试删除,运行很长时间后,undo不够用报错。决定,truancate该分区。查看表的分区,发现存在数个全局索引和本地索引,百度一下对分区表某分区进行drop/truncate操作。 ① 马上回收空间:  a

2017-07-03 10:48:15 25375 1

原创 WARNING OGG-00869 Aborting BATCHSQL transaction

由于处理ogg-01031,详见找到目标端的复制进程后,stop该进程,报等待超时的错误。检查report2017-06-13 11:06:51 INFO OGG-01139 BATCHSQL resumed, recovered from error.2017-06-13 11:14:02 WARNING OGG-00869 Aborting BATCHSQL

2017-06-13 14:20:39 4200

原创 OGG-01223 TCP/IP error 111

今天一套11.2.0.4RAC 的一个节点由于仲裁盘原因offline导致部署在该节点上的ogg出现问题。该节点正常后启动ogg发现抽取、复制进程都ok,所有投递进程都abend。-----------------------------------------------------------------------------------------------------检查r

2017-06-13 14:13:31 3555

翻译 参数ENABLE_GOLDENGATE_REPLICATION

APPLIES TO:Oracle GoldenGate - Version 11.2.0.0.0 and laterInformation in this document applies to any platform.PURPOSETo better track GoldenGate product license, a new database init p

2017-06-12 15:58:44 2280

原创 ogg为什么需要def文件

在《GoldenGate企业级运维实战》一书中提到用defgen来生成def文件为rep进程使用。原话如下:"当源库与目标库类型不一样或者源端的表与目标端的表结构不相同时,数据定义文件是必须有的。"                                                             ----------------------《GoldenGate企业级

2017-06-09 14:50:56 3898

转载 关于在一套复制环境中使用不同版本OGG的问题.

关于在一套复制环境中使用不同版本OGG的问题.1.源头OGG版本低,目的端OGG版本高,此种配置不需要做任何的额外改动.跟两端是相同OGG版本的同步是完全一样的参数设置.2.源头OGG版本高,目的端OGG版本低,此种配置需要在源头的抽取进程和传输进程的参数文件中设置trailfile的格式(设置为跟目的端OGG版本一样的格式).[html] view p

2017-05-15 14:05:40 651

转载 复制Oracle数据库中文字符集AMERICAN_AMERICA.ZHS16GBK到目的库Oracle字符集AL32UTF8

复制Oracle数据库中文字符集AMERICAN_AMERICA.ZHS16GBK到目的库Oracle字符集AL32UTF8翻译自:Replicate Chinese Characters AMERICAN_AMERICA.ZHS16GBK to target charset AL32UTF8, Oracle to Oracle, 11.1 and before 11.2 (Doc I

2017-05-15 13:56:41 11256

翻译 Extract Abends with OGG-01028 Non-Standard Redo Detected in 10g Compatible Format (文档 ID 1313864.1)

Extract Abends with OGG-01028 Non-Standard Redo Detected in 10g Compatible Format (文档 ID 1313864.1) --------------------------------------------------------------------------------In this Docum

2017-05-04 11:24:35 1792

oracle补丁

解决通过数据泵将10g库迁移到11g库时报错ORA-39126、ORA-01555

2018-02-08

coe_xfr_sql_profile

coe_xfr_sql_profile 工具适用9.2和10.1

2016-10-13

sqlt_latest.zip

绑定执行计划所需的一个代码类的工具适用于10.2以后版本

2016-10-13

pdksh-5.2.14-36.el5.x86_64.rpm

安装oracle 报错pdksh包缺少或冲突

2016-09-19

配置ssh互信

配置ssh互信

2016-06-07

dbupgdiag.sql

oracle的升级检查脚本,可以在升级之前查看数据库需要做什么改动

2016-05-20

Oracle.多表连接.rar

这几年收集于网络的一些关于oracle的文档,希望对你有帮助。

2012-11-25

Oracle语法详解2.rar

前些年自己整理的一些关于oracle的电子文档,希望对你有帮助。

2012-11-25

Oracle语法详解1.rar

这几年收集的一些文档,希望对你有帮助,欢迎大家下载交流。

2012-11-25

oracle 资料

这些年自己和朋友弄得一些老的从9i开始的一些资料

2012-11-25

空空如也

TA创建的收藏夹 TA关注的收藏夹

TA关注的人

提示
确定要删除当前文章?
取消 删除